Daniel Peddle

Daniel Peddle is an artist, author, and filmmaker whose work blends visual storytelling with an intimate sense of character and place. His publishing career began with Snow Day, a wordless book he created at fifteen years old. Published years later — after a chance encounter with a Random House editor on the subway while Daniel was a graduate film student at New York University— this formative moment affirmed his belief in the power of storytelling.

Daniel has written and directed six award-winning feature films, both documentary and narrative. He also has a long career in casting, where he has discovered hundreds of models and actors — including Jennifer Lawrence — through his instinctive eye for authenticity.

Raised in rural North Carolina, Daniel grew up exploring the woods, an early connection to nature that continues to shape his vision. Though he works across disciplines, each project informs the next, united by a commitment to revealing the universalities of the human experience. This interconnected practice is grounded in a child-like curiosity and a deep respect for all life.
